What affects the price

The final cost for your chimney service depends on a few specific factors. We look at the total height of the chimney stack, the level of creosote buildup inside the flue, and whether you have a standard masonry fireplace or a prefabricated metal insert. If there are structural blockages like nests or excessive debris that require extra labor, that will also adjust the estimate. We avoid hidden fees, but every setup is unique, so we evaluate the condition of your liner and firebox upon inspection.

What specific services are included when I get my chimney cleaned near Fort Worth?

When you schedule chimney cleaning services near Fort Worth, you can expect a comprehensive cleaning of your flue system to remove accumulated soot and creosote, which are flammable byproducts of combustion. This process typically involves using specialized brushes and vacuums to ensure no debris remains. The service also includes a visual inspection of the accessible portions of your chimney, firebox, and damper to identify any potential safety hazards or structural issues. This thorough examination helps ensure your chimney operates efficiently and safely. The specialists aim to leave your system in optimal condition.

Are there specific types of chimney cleaning or 'sweeping' services available?

Yes, there are specific types of chimney cleaning and sweeping services designed to address various needs. Standard sweeping involves the removal of soot and creosote from the flue liner using specialized brushes and rods. More intensive services may include cleaning the smoke chamber, throat, and firebox, especially if significant creosote buildup is present. Some services also focus on specific materials, like ensuring a clean sweep for wood-burning stoves or ensuring proper ventilation for gas appliances. The goal is always to restore optimal airflow and safety.
